The Healthcare Manager is responsible for successfully supporting patients with high risk health conditions to navigate the healthcare system. The Healthcare Manager assists in developing patient empowerment by acting as an educator, resource, and advocate for patients and their families to ensure a maximum quality of life. The Healthcare Manager interacts and collaborates with multidisciplinary care teams, to include physicians, nurses, pharmacists, laboratory technologists, social workers, and other educators. The Healthcare Manager acts as a resource for clinic staff. The Healthcare Manager works in a less structured, self-directed environment and performs all nursing duties within the scope of a RN license of the applicable state board of nursing.

**Primary Responsibilities**:

- Works with the providers and clinic staff to identify patients at high risk telephonically primarily
- Supports longitudinal care of the patient with chronic care conditions by:

- performing assessment of health conditions
- performing medication reconciliation
- conducting Motivational Interviewing and Self-Management Goal setting
- providing patient education, creating referrals to appropriate agencies and resources
- Supports transition of the patient with chronic care conditions from inpatient to outpatient setting, by:

- performing assessment of transitional needs
- performing medication reconciliation
- establishing and reviewing contingency plan
- providing patient education
- assisting with post discharge needs such as prescriptions, transportation, Durable Medical Equipment (DME), appointments
- Coordinate with providers to establish or update plan of care
- Performs accurate and timely documentation in the electronic medical record
- Participates in daily huddles and Patient Care Coordination (PCC) meetings
- Prepares accurate and timely reports, as required, for weekly meetings
- Maintains continued competence in nursing practice and knowledge of current evidence-based practices
- May perform clinical tasks within their scope of practice

**Required Qualifications**:

- Bachelor’s degree in Nursing or Associate’s degree in Nursing with 2+ years of experience
- Registered Nurse with an active and unrestricted license to practice in the state of employment
- Current BLS certification
- 2+ years of experience in a physician’s office, clinical or hospital setting
- Knowledge of chronic diseases, COPD / asthma, diabetes, CHF and IHD
- Proficient computer skills to work efficiently with electronic medical records
- This position requires Tuberculosis screening as well as proof of immunity to Measles, Mumps, Rubella, Varicella, Tetanus, Diphtheria, and Pertussis through lab confirmation of immunity, documented evidence of vaccination, or a doctor’s diagnosis of disease

**Preferred Qualifications**:

- BSN
- Certified Case Manager (CCM)
- Case management experience
- Experience or exposure to discharge planning
- Experience in utilization review, concurrent review or risk management
- Experience in a telephonic role
- Background in managed care
